Why SpaceX’s Technology is Game-Changing

One of the primary factors that set SpaceX apart from traditional aerospace companies is its focus on reusability. The Falcon 9 rocket is designed to land back on Earth after deploying its payload, allowing it to be refurbished and flown again. This technology not only reduces costs but also minimizes waste, laying the groundwork for sustainable space travel.
